New York Licensed Psychologist Continuing Education Requirements
New York PSYs need 36 continuing education (CE) hours every 36 months (3 years) to renew their license.
Required CE topics
These hours are part of the 36-hour total — not in addition to it.
| Topic | Hours |
|---|---|
| Professional Ethics (incl. NY laws/rules) | 3 |
| Professional Boundaries | 3 |
Renewal cycle
36-month triennial registration period. Mandatory CE took effect 2021-01-01; the professional-boundaries requirement applies to periods commencing on or after 2023-04-01.
Documentation to keep
- dated certificate with ce hours
- nysed approved sponsor documentation
- records retained for department audit
